Smoke alarms alert you with three beeps in a row. Carbon monoxide alarms alert you with four beeps. A single chirp means the battery is low or the detector should be replaced. Some newer alarms also have a voice that gives you directions. Other alarms, made for people who are deaf or hard of hearing, shake your pillow or have a strobe light. ...Different Types of Beeps and Chirps from Carbon Monoxide Detectors: 4 Beeps and a Pause: EMERGENCY. This means that carbon monoxide has been detected in the area, you should move to fresh air and call 9-1-1. 1 Beep Every Minute: Low Battery. It is time to replace the batteries in your carbon monoxide alarm. 5 Beeps Every Minute: End of Life.The Battery Powered Smoke & Carbon Monoxide Detector (2-AA batteries included), model 900-CUDR, is equipped with self-testing components that are always checking to make sure the alarm is on and working.*. Smoke particles of varying number and size are produced in all fires. For maximum protection, use both ionization and photoelectric sensing ...If hot, or if you see smoke seeping through cracks, do not open that door! Instead, use your alternate exit. If the inside of the door is cool, place your shoulder against it, open it slightly, and be ready to slam it shut if heat and smoke rush in. Stay close to the floor if the air is smoky. Breathe shallowly through a cloth, wet if possible.

The Red LED flashes rapidly. • If the unit alarms get everyone out of the house immediately.A drop in room temperature increases this resistance, which may impact the battery's ability to deliver the power necessary to operate the unit in an alarm situation. This battery characteristic can cause a smoke alarm to enter the low battery chirp mode when air temperatures drop. Most homes are the coolest between 2 a.m. and 6 a.m.Now that we have explored the features and specifications of the First Alert carbon monoxide detector, let’s uncover the meaning behind specific alarm patterns, such as the 3 beeps, and learn what they indicate.
